Summary
Bronze medal, Emperor Napoleon III, Emperor of France (1808-1873) commemorating the Paris Exhibition of 1867 by François Joseph Hubert Ponscarme (Belmont-lès-Darney 1827 - Malakoff 1903). Presented to Disraeli. Obverse with head of Napoleon III facing left, inscribed 'Napoleon III Empereur' and with maker's name 'H. Ponscarme F.' Reverse has two cherubs holding plague inscribed 'Benjamin Disraeli' above an eagle. Further inscriptions on reverse 'Exposition universelle de MDCCCLXVII a Paris', 'pour services rendus' and 'H. Ponscarme'. The rim of the medal is inscribed with a small symbol and then the word 'cuivre'. Part of a set (see NT/HUG/V/31a-d).
